SSE India recently marked a significant milestone — the closing of the Social Start-Up Fellowship Programme in Uttarakhand, supported by Rail Vikas Nigam Limited.
At Dehradun, during the event hosted by Mukhyamantri Udyamshala Yojana, our Fellows stepped into a new space — not just to showcase products, but to own their entrepreneurial identity.
For many, this was their first-ever public pitch.
The first time standing behind their idea.
The first time being heard.
And that changes everything.
From handmade innovations to grassroots business models, the room was filled with raw ambition, local wisdom, and quiet courage. More importantly, it was a safe space — where entrepreneurs could experiment, articulate, and grow without fear.
We are also proud to share that SSE India signed an MoU with Mukhyamantri Udyamshala Yojana, strengthening our commitment to build and support the next generation of entrepreneurs in Uttarakhand.
The presence of our Chairperson, Indraneel Roy Choudhury, and Hon. Minister of Rural Development, Bharat Singh Chudhary, added both encouragement and intent to this shared vision.
